About the Activity:

  • Arrive at the activity site and prepare to tour The Oude Church, one of Amsterdam's oldest churches, which is situated in the city's red-light district.
  • Explore the church, which was constructed as a symbol of the Beeldenstorm that took place on August 23, 1566. It holds a special place in the Dutch and European cultural history.
  • Get engaged in the religious service of the Protestant Oude Kerk community, which has been held here since the changes in 1578.
  • After the worship service, marvel at the church's exquisite interior and stunning architecture, and be astounded by its stained glass and red window.
  • Admire the magnificent paintings created by renowned artists, the furnishings, and the two organs that are kept in the church in a tidy and attractive manner.
  • Pay your respects at the graves of Jan Pieterszoon Sweelinck, a renowned Dutch composer and organist, and Saskia van Uylenburgh, the famed painter Rembrandt van Rijn's wife.
